What is the distance traveled by an object per unit of time?
speed
What branch of physics addresses the effects of forces on matter?
mechanics
What type of mathematical quantity, often represented by arrows, has both magnitude and direction?
vector (quantity)
What is the formula for average velocity?
velocity equals displacement divided by time
How do you find the magnitude of total displacement when the directions are the same or opposite.
Use signed numbers to represent direction, ie. positive for north and negative for south. Add the signed numbers
What is the study of motion and forces?
dynamics
